For speed ball I have a
Freeflow autococker
*MQ Valve
*ANS version of the RaceGun trigger
*Halo-B hopper with major upgrades
*Freak Barrel system
Too many other mods to list, but it will sustain 23.5 balls per second without any drop off, empties the hopper in less than 8 seconds, no ball breakage and still accurate.
